Tariku Gankisi's song "Dishta Gina" carries a powerful message of love, peace and unity in the face of Ethiopia's ongoing political turmoil and warfare[2][3]. The song has gained immense popularity, reaching over 23 million views on RUclips[2]. Gankisi, a former soldier who witnessed the horrors of the Ethio-Eritrean war, uses his music to preach against violence and promote reconciliation[2][3]. "Dishta Gina" was born out of his life experiences and desire to convey a message of humanity[3]. The song's success has allowed Gankisi's message to spread across Africa[2]. It even caught the attention of Akon, who collaborated with Gankisi on a remix[2]. However, Gankisi faced controversy when he made a statement against war during a performance, urging the audience to give peace a chance[3]. Despite the backlash, Gankisi remains steadfast in his message of love and unity through his music[3]. "Dishta Gina" continues to spark important conversations and raise awareness about the need for peace in Ethiopia[2].

In Ethiopia their are more than 87 to 104 nations.. Each nations have their own cultures traditions ways of clothing ,eating house building, medication, wedding ceremonies....so on Also they have many common traditions! According to music each have different music using their own language and different ways of dancing...also most of them have their own unique music equipments that can not found any other place in the world.! Mostly you're seeing ethopian music equipments are which are commonly used In most of ethopian nations!! This all music's ,dances and music equipments are not still published in the professional or modern international ways..! That's why they are hidden.... we have alots of works to do about it.... believe me it's a treasure ❤
